Terrorist released from Guantanamo Bay after convincing officials he was no longer a threat to the West is killed fighting for Al Qaeda in Syria

    Video apparently showing Mohammed Al Alami's funeral was posted online
    In it he is praised for spending time in Guantanamo 'where he did not reform'
    The 37-year-old was caught trying to cross Afghan Pakistan border in 2001
    Admitted in interrogation at military base that he was Al Qaeda fighter

A video allegedly showing Mohamed Al Alami's funeral was posted online last week

A former Guantanamo Bay prisoner who fought against British and US forces in Afghanistan has been killed while fighting for Al Qaeda in Syria.

Mohammed Al Alami was released from the top-security detention centre in 2006 after convincing officials that he was no longer a threat to the West.

The 37-year-old, who spent four years in custody, claimed he confessed to being a terrorist only after being beaten and threatened with death.

But it has now been revealed that he was killed last month while fighting for Al Nusra Front, one of the most violent and ruthless Islamic groups in Syria.
